CSS是指層疊樣式表(Cascading Style Sheets),與HTML共同構成Web網頁的重要組成部分。CSS提供了豐富的樣式和布局控制,使網頁呈現更為美觀和可讀,增強了用戶體驗。
在CSS中,可以很方便地對各種元素進行樣式調整。對于下劃線,也可以使用CSS來實現縮放效果。下面我們來看一下如何進行相關編寫。
/* 使用CSS對下劃線縮放 */ /* 給下劃線所在容器設置相對定位 */ .parent { position: relative; width: 200px; height: 100px; } /* 給下劃線設置絕對定位 */ .underline { position: absolute; bottom: 0; left: 0; width: 100%; height: 1px; background-color: #000; transition: transform 0.3s ease; } /* 鼠標覆蓋時,下劃線縮放 */ .parent:hover .underline { transform: scaleX(2); }
如上代碼所示,首先需要給下劃線所在的容器設置相對定位(position: relative;
),這樣下劃線就可以相對于父級容器進行定位。然后,給下劃線設置絕對定位(position: absolute;
)以及寬度、高度、顏色等屬性,使其呈現出下劃線的效果。最后,在鼠標覆蓋時(:hover
),使用transform
屬性來進行下劃線縮放。
在實現上述效果時,還需要了解一些其他的CSS屬性,例如transition
用于設置動畫效果,scaleX()
用于沿x軸縮放元素等等。
通過上述示例,我們可以看到CSS在對下劃線縮放方面具有較強的控制力,為網頁設計提供了更加自由和豐富的樣式處理方式,使得產生的效果更加美觀和生動。